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/7] PCI: qcom: Add IPQ9574 PCIe support


On 2/20/2023 7:11 PM, Devi Priya wrote:
> Hi Sri,
> Thanks for taking time to review the patch!
>
> On 2/16/2023 5:08 PM, Sricharan Ramabadhran wrote:
>> Hi Devi,
>>
>> On 2/14/2023 10:11 PM, Devi Priya wrote:
>>> Adding PCIe support for IPQ9574 SoC
>>>
>>> Co-developed-by: Anusha Rao <quic_anusha@...cinc.com>
>>> Signed-off-by: Anusha Rao <quic_anusha@...cinc.com>
>>> Signed-off-by: Devi Priya <quic_devipriy@...cinc.com>
>>> ---
>>>   dr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-qcom.c | 119 
>>> +++++++++++++++++++++++++
>>>   1 file changed, 119 insertions(+)

>>
>>    I do not see much difference between 2_9_0 and 1_27_0. Is this patch
>>    really required. Can you check if it works with 2_9_0 itself ?
> Yes right Sri, Only the clocks seem to differ between 2_9_0 and 1_27_0.
> Will update 2_9_0 ops to get the clocks from the DT and use the same 
> for ipq9574 in the next spin.
